Why carrots and oranges?

Kids find it much easier to learn when they’ve eat good healthy food. Taking a carrot and orange will help them do better in class and sport.
School-aged children need at least three servings of vegetables and two servings of fruit every day.

Hint: Try cutting the carrot into sticks to make it easier to eat

Healthy habits to last kids a life time

• Give them raw veges, like carrot sticks, to snack on while you’re cooking tea.
• Let them serve up their own veges and make sure they see you eating yours!
• Make the veges look appealing – try serving up a mixture of colours.
